Detailed Breakdown of the Tour
Starting Point and Early Pickup
Your adventure begins bright and early around 7:30 am, with hotel pickup by your private guide. This is a big plus—no waiting in lines or crowded buses—just a leisurely ride in a plush, air-conditioned vehicle. From the get-go, the focus on comfort and exclusivity sets the tone for the day.
Calmsley Hill Farm: Wildlife Close-Ups
The first stop is at Calmsley Hill, a working farm that is more than just a tourist spot; it’s a chance to connect with Australia’s native animals up-close. Expect to see kangaroos, wombats, koalas, and emus—many of which you can touch and photograph. According to reviews, visitors appreciate the opportunity to get close, with one noting, “get up close with the animals for photos.” The inclusion of morning tea adds a cozy, relaxed start to the day.
Exploring the Blue Mountains’ Scenic Marvels
After the farm, your guide takes you into Blue Mountains National Park, a UNESCO World Heritage site known for eucalyptus forests, sandstone formations, and rugged ravines. Traveling in a private vehicle means you can access lesser-visited lookouts, avoiding the big crowds. Expect to see stunning vistas at Govetts Leap, where a waterfall plunges 180 meters into the valley below, or catch a glimpse of the iconic Three Sisters rock formation from a vantage point accessible only by small vehicles. One reviewer mentions this aspect, highlighting that the tour “visits some of the best locations of the canyons, valleys, and scenic spots.”

The Legend of the Three Sisters
The Three Sisters is more than just a photo op—it’s steeped in Aboriginal legend. Your guide will share stories about the lore behind this natural landmark, enriching your understanding of the landscape’s cultural significance. The stop here is brief, about 20 minutes, but impactful enough to leave a lasting impression.
Gourmet Lunch at the Hydro Majestic Hotel
Midday, you’ll enjoy a well-deserved rest and a 2-course meal at the Hydro Majestic Hotel, a striking piece of architecture overlooking Megalong Valley. The menu varies seasonally, with options accommodating most diets. You can choose between a relaxed meal at the Boiler House Cafe—where drinks are available—or a more refined experience at Echoes Restaurant, which offers a glass of wine or beer with your meal. Multiple reviews praise the quality of the food and the spectacular views, making this a true highlight of the trip.
Scenic Lookouts and Waterfalls
Post-lunch, your guide takes you to other scenic spots like Govetts Leap, where you can gaze over the awe-inspiring waterfall and rugged cliffs. This stop lasts around 20 minutes but is packed with photo opportunities and awe-inspiring views. If time permits, a visit to the Blue Mountains Botanic Garden allows you to stroll through cool-climate plants from around Australia and the world, providing a peaceful end to the sightseeing.
